UBS reiterates a 'Buy' on Johnson & Johnson (NYSE: JNJ) price target of $76.00 (from $70.00).

Analyst, Rajeev Jashnani, said, "Proabably the biggest point of contention that we hear on JNJ relates to valuation. While the stock does trade at 10% & 8% premiums to US large cap med tech & pharma groups, it is not clear to us that these broad averages are relevant comps. In med tech, JNJ has less exposure to sluggish cardio/ortho end-markets. In pharma, outlook vs. US peers is also fairly wide, as JNJ revs could grow at 6% over next 3 yrs vs. flattish for the broader group. JNJ trades at a ~30% discount to consumer.
